Up to 50 millimeters of rain expected today.
Three separate yellow warnings for wind and rain are in place this afternoon as the country experiences unseasonably wet and windy weather.
Two yellow wind warnings are in place for Cork and Kerry and Waterford and Wexford while a yellow rain warning is in place for Clare, Cork, Kerry, Waterford, Galway and Mayo.
